Why It Took So Long
The Cybertruck is not a conventional truck. Anyone who has spent real time with one off-road knows that beneath the stainless steel exterior, you are dealing with a vehicle that is genuinely different from anything that came before it. Factory air suspension with multiple ride height modes. Steer-by-wire with no mechanical connection between the steering wheel and the front wheels. Rear-wheel steering for tighter turning radius and better stability. Ride height sensors integrated into the suspension geometry. These are not features you can ignore when you start lifting the truck. They are features you have to build around.
Early on, we discovered something that motivated the entire development program. The factory upper control arm on the Cybertruck has limited range of motion. When the truck is pushed hard off-road, under heavy compression, the upper control arm can contact the body of the vehicle. In some extreme scenarios, this causes real damage. It was a fundamental limitation that a simple spacer lift would not address and could actually make it worse.
On top of that, the most common approach we saw in the market was alarming to us. Lifting the Cybertruck by tricking the ride height sensors causes the factory air suspension to overextend in order to reach the desired height. When you lift the suspension without any supporting modifications, you risk losing all suspension droop and potentially causing shock piston failure at full extension. That kind of failure does not happen in your driveway. It happens on a trail, at speed, in the middle of nowhere. We knew from the start that this approach was not acceptable so we built something better.
How the Cybertruck Lift Kit Actually Works
The UP INVINCIBLE® 2.5-inch Lift Kit is a system that sits between the subframe and the chassis of the vehicle. This is the critical distinction. By lifting the body relative to the subframe, you gain 2.5 inches of ground clearance while the factory suspension continues to operate exactly as Tesla designed it. The air suspension still manages ride height. The shocks still move through their full designed range of motion. Nothing is being tricked, overextended, or stressed beyond its intended limits.
Because the body moves up but the subframe stays in its original position relative to the wheels, we had to develop new high-clearance front and rear upper control arms to accommodate the new geometry and maintain the correct sensor positions for the factory air suspension. These arms are machined from 6061-T6 billet aluminum using 5-axis CNC equipment. They are fully adjustable for camber, caster, and toe, so your alignment can be dialed in correctly regardless of how you have the truck set up. Uprated bushings and joints throughout the kit mean you are not trading durability for capability.
The kit also includes a strong underbody armor system designed to compensate for the new vehicle height and protect the truck’s underside during off-road use. The underbody protection also smooths airflow underneath the front and rear subframe, which helps offset some of the aerodynamic impact of the increased ride height. Note that the underbody protection is designed to work with the UP INVINCIBLE front and rear bumpers only.
Built and Broken and Built Again
The best part of this story is not that we built a lift kit. It is that we were honest enough to race it before we sold it.
Earlier this year, we installed the prototype lift kit on the only Cybertruck competing in the Las Vegas Mint 400, one of the most demanding off-road races in the United States. It is the kind of race where the terrain finds every weakness in your design within the first few miles. And sure enough, it found one. An attachment pin failed on course. We had to stop, repair the truck with help from the off-road community on the spot, and keep going.
We did not officially complete the race with that pin failure. But here is what that day gave us: a real failure under conditions that 99.99% of Cybertruck owners will never come close to replicating. We know exactly what broke, why it broke, and what it took to fix it. No simulation, no test bench, no closed course could have given us that data.
Our engineers went back, redesigned the failed component from scratch with a fully reinforced construction, and reduced the overall component count to eliminate other potential points of failure. The goal was straightforward: make the system stronger and more robust in every dimension. What you are buying now is that final, production-ready iteration. Not the prototype. Not the race version. The version that was designed knowing exactly where the limits are.

Living With the Lift Kit Day to Day, Including Full Self-Driving
One of the most common questions we get is how this kit interacts with Full Self-Driving. The short answer is that because the lift kit retains the full factory suspension and sensor systems, the truck continues to function as Tesla designed it from a software perspective. FSD uses cameras, radar, and onboard sensors to navigate, and nothing about this lift kit interferes with those systems. The ride height modes remain fully operational, so if you use FSD for highway commuting, the truck can still lower itself for efficiency just as it would from the factory.
That said, Tesla continues to develop and update FSD, and we cannot predict every way the software might evolve. Our approach has always been to build hardware that works with the factory systems rather than replacing them, so if Tesla pushes an update that changes how ride height logic works, the factory system underneath is still intact and able to adapt. As always, we recommend staying current with Tesla software updates and monitoring any relevant changes that may affect modified vehicles.
*Note that this lift kit may reduce range at highway speeds due to the increased ride height and aerodynamic profile.

Will installing Unplugged Performance parts void my Tesla warranty?
Installing aftermarket parts does not automatically void your Tesla warranty. Under the Magnusson-Moss Warranty Act (www.sema.org/sema-enews/2011/01/ftc-validates-right-to-install-aftermarket-parts), a manufacturer cannot void your warranty simply because you installed aftermarket parts. Tesla must prove that the aftermarket part caused the specific failure in question to deny a warranty claim. UP recommends retaining all factory parts to allow reverting to stock if needed.
